History
The company was established through the integration of two industry pioneers: Draka, known for creating the world’s first tubing-encapsulated cable (TEC) over 30 years ago, and Gulf Coast Downhole Technologies (GCDT), which specializes in addressing the challenges faced by operators and oil field service companies. TEC (Instrumentation & Power Cables)
Tubing Encased Cable (TEC) is specially designed and manufactured to withstand the harsh conditions typically encountered in the oil and gas industry. This cable is suitable for data transmission in applications such as downhole gauges, powering larger cores, or serving both purposes.

Hybrid cables are custom-designed electro-optical cables tailored to meet specific customer requirements. There are two primary design methods:
- Two separate tubes: One tube is dedicated to electrical conductors (TEC), and the other is for optical fibers (TEF). These tubes are positioned side by side in a flat pack.
- A single tube: This design combines a twisted conductor and fiber, all enclosed within a metal tube (FIMT).
These methods ensure the unique needs of each customer are effectively met.

Flatpacks
Flatpacks are designed to simplify the installation process and minimize the number of installation spooler units needed during well completion. They are available in various configurations, such as single-pass and dual-pass encapsulation, which provide enhanced protection. Additionally, individual components and tubes can be color-coded and customized with printed labels for easy identification. If extra crush resistance is necessary, options such as bumper bars and wire rope can be included.
Safety-Strip®
The standard PDT flatpack design features the patented Safety-Strip® encapsulation. This design includes a continuous tear cord, which allows for the safe and quick removal of the outer jacket without damaging the underlying tube. This innovation greatly improves operator safety by eliminating the need for open blades or other mechanical tools for stripping the cable.
Protectors
Protectors are designed to safeguard all control lines and cables along the entire length of the production string, significantly reducing the risk of damage to cables, control lines, or flatpacks. PDT’s Protector portfolio includes clamping and cable protection solutions that shield cables from lateral, axial, and rotational forces in downhole applications.
